ENGLISH | PRONUNCIATION
ENGLISH |
TURKISH | PRONUNCIATION BRAZILIAN
PORTUGUESE |
BRAZILIAN PORTUGUESE |
A ROOM | oh dah | ODA | odá | UM QUARTO |
A BATHROOM | bah nyoh | BANYO | banío | UM BANHEIRO |
A BEDROOM | yah tahk oh dah suh | YATAK ODASI | iátak odasâ | UM QUARTO DE DORMIR |
A HALL | Hohl | HOL | hoL | UM HALL |
A CELLAR | kih lehr / boh droom | KİLER / BODRUM | kilér / bodrúm | UMA ADEGA |
A DINNING ROOM | yeh mehk oh dah suh | YEMEK ODASI | iemek odasâ | UMA SALA DO JANTAR |
A LIVING ROOM | oh tour mah oh dah suh | OTURMA ODASI | oturmá odasâ | UMA SALA DE ESTAR |
- Room - Oda
- Attic - Çatı Katı
- Bathroom - Banyo
- Bedroom - Yatak odası
- Hall - Hol
- Cellar - Kiler/Bodrum
- Dinning room - Yemek odası
- Living room - Oturma odası
